Nissan 370Z Launched in India - with actual launch images

January 21, 2010, 10:10 IST by Quraish Umrethi

Amidst much fanfare at the Juhu Flying Club, Nissan launched its latest iconic sports model Nissan 370Z in India. The unveiling ceremony started in the morning when we were taken to the venue in a White open double-decker bus to view the spectacular 370Z car. The car dashed out of a black van and stopped only after a few fast runs on the ground. There were a few displays of the car with Burnouts and 360s and finally ace driver of India, Narayan Karthikeyan emerged from the car.

After the dramatic introduction of the car to the press, Nissan Managing Director and CEO, Kiminobu Tokuyama officially introduced the car for the Indian customers.

“These are exciting times for all of us at Nissan and in our effort to provide the Indian customers with an experience of our full range of products, we are delighted to launch our very popular and iconic sports car -370Z in India. The 370Z has been conceived as an "Everyday Sports Car," bringing to life the sweet spot of performance, style and value, which symbolizes the DNA of Nissan cars. It's an authentic sports car that you don't have to make sacrifices to own – or drive every day. We believe that the 370Z will create an aspirational value for Nissan brand in the country as we gear up for the launch of our first made in India car in 2010,” said Tokuyama while introducing the car to the press.

We were then allowed to feast ourselves and our lenses on the magnificent red beauty (see the Nissan 370Z pictures below) thereafter followed by a Q&A session.

Nissan 370Z model in India is powered by VQ37VHR 3.7 L DOHC (Double Overhead Camshaft) V6 engine that delivers a power of 333 PS and 363 Nm Torque. The car is available in eight attractive colours and two interior leather colour options (Persimmon Orange and Black) available in both Manual and Automatic Transmissions.

Nissan 370Z 6-speed manual transmission model is priced at Rs. 53.5 lakh and the 7-speed automatic transmission model with manual shift is tagged with Rs. 54.5 lakh.
